What is a Bridge of Boats?
A Bridge of Boats is a pedestrian- or light-traffic crossing produced by arranging boats or hulls side by side to form a stable surface. The buoyancy of the vessels supports weight and distributes loads across multiple hulls, resulting in a surprisingly solid walkway. This makeshift crossing can be assembled quickly from available craft and removed when no longer needed. The term is widely understood in Britain and across Europe, though similar concepts appear in coastal and river communities worldwide.
Bridge of Boats vs. Pontoon Bridge
Understanding the distinction between a Bridge of Boats and a pontoon bridge helps with planning and risk assessment. A pontoon bridge uses dedicated pontoons and a purpose-built deck, whereas a Bridge of Boats relies on actual hulls lashed together. In practice, many projects blend boats with pontoons to optimise stiffness and load distribution. The terminology matters for maintenance, insurance, and public perception during events or emergencies.

Design Principles and Core Components
Successful Bridge of Boats projects hinge on stability, buoyancy, safety, and governance. Designers balance simplicity with redundancy to deliver a dependable crossing in varying conditions. The following components are commonly involved in robust arrangements:
- Boats or hulls: The primary buoyant units. A mix of smaller craft or larger barges can be used, arranged to form a continuous deck.
- Decking and surface: A durable, non-slip surface that offers a consistent walking path across all hulls.
- Moorings and securing lines: Strong tethering to banks, anchors, or fixed points to control drift and maintain alignment.
- Fenders and protective edging: Cushioned barriers to reduce hull-to-hull contact and to protect pedestrians.
- Ramps and access points: Safe approaches for pedestrians and cyclists to enter and exit the floating deck.
- Guard rails and lighting: Essential safety features, especially during low light and inclement weather.
- Temporary works and supervision: Trained crews monitor weather, crowd movement, and structural integrity during use.
In practice, a Bridge of Boats benefits from a deliberate, well-documented layout. A modest distribution of hulls with multiple lashings and cross-bracing can yield a remarkably stiff platform. Where space allows, engineers may incorporate a central spine or a pattern of cross-links to reduce sway and improve load paths.
Even as a temporary solution, a Bridge of Boats must meet safety expectations. Planners typically model pedestrian loads, potential wheel loads from bicycles or carts, and environmental influences such as wind and current. A clear safety margin is standard practice to guard against unexpected crowd surges or weather shifts. Signage, barriers, and a trained on-site supervisor are common components of a sound safety regime.
Planning a Bridge of Boats for an Event or Project
If you are considering a Bridge of Boats for a festival, community project, or emergency response, methodical planning pays dividends. A well-executed floating crossing can deliver practical benefits and create a focal point for attendees. The following considerations help translate concept into a secure, successful installation.
Step-by-step overview
- Define purpose and load expectations: Identify who will use the bridge and when. Will it carry pedestrians, cyclists, wheelchairs, or light maintenance vehicles?
- Assess site and environmental conditions: Evaluate current, wind, tidal flows, water depth, and riverbank access for anchoring.
- Obtain permissions and coordinate with authorities: Engage local councils, harbour masters, and safety regulators. Temporary constructions on public waters often require permits.
- Assemble the design team: Involve engineers where possible, marina staff, event planners, and safety personnel to oversee construction and operation.
- Plan erection and decommission: Set a realistic timetable, identify inspection checkpoints, and outline contingency plans for adverse weather.
Practical tips for the build
- Choose compatible vessels: Aim for similar hull form and buoyancy to promote even loading and stability.
- Ensure robust connections: Use reliable lashings and cross-bracing to minimise flex.
- Prioritise accessibility: Implement ramps with appropriate gradients and non-slip decking.
- Install safety features: Guard rails, lighting, and clear wayfinding signage are key to public confidence.

Maintenance, Inspection, and Operational Readiness
Ongoing maintenance is essential for safety and reliability. Regular inspections should assess hull integrity, lashings, moorings, decking, guard rails, and lighting. Weather events can alter buoyancy and alignment, so flexible maintenance regimes and responsive teams are valuable. Documentation of tests, loads, and repairs helps ensure the Bridge of Boats remains fit for purpose across seasons, and that any improvements are tracked for future deployments.
